What are the possible isomers of C6H10?

What are the possible isomers of C6H10?

C6H10

  • Cyclohexene.
  • 2,3-Dimethyl-1,3-butadiene.
  • 1,3-Hexadiene.
  • 1,4-Hexadiene.
  • 1,5-Hexadiene.
  • 2,4-Hexadiene.
  • 1-Hexyne.
  • 2-Hexyne.

What functional group is found in C6H10?

Structure of Cyclohexene Its chemical formula is C6 H10. It is a six-membered carbon ring with a double bond in between two of the carbon atoms. When an organic compound has a carbon-carbon double bond we call it an alkene. This is the functional group of the molecule.

What type of hydrocarbon is C6H10?

Cyclohexene
Cyclohexene is a hydrocarbon with the formula C6H10. This cycloalkene is a colorless liquid with a sharp smell. It is an intermediate in various industrial processes.

Is C6H10 saturated or unsaturated?

Cyclohexene is a cycloalkene with the formula of C6H10. It is nearly similar to cyclohexane, but there is one double bond between two carbon atoms in the ring, which makes it an unsaturated hydrocarbon.

What are the different types of isomers in science?

There are several categories of isomers, including structural isomers,geometric isomers , optical isomers and stereoisomers. The two broad categories of isomers are structural isomers (also called constitutional isomers) and stereoisomers (also called spatial isomers).
